Meh. More than last week this one really suffered for lack of time. I could see a proper four or six part serial in there struggling to get out, but because of the modern format everyone was reduced to rushing about frantically, with at least three or four interesting characters who would have played major parts in an old style serial getting few or no lines. It's frustrating more than anything else, that you can see what could have been.
